A … WebApr 12, 2024 · On average, a conventional tank-style electric water heater lasts 10–15 years, while gas-powered models typically last 5–15 years. However, there are several factors that can affect its longevity. The age of the unit is one of the most important considerations. Older models, especially those manufactured before 1995, tend to have shorter ...

CEE recommends replacing your water heater with one that (1) is efficient, and (2) has sealed combustion venting.
